API bug: parallel tool wrapper included even if there are no functions, by an empty tool list (CC)

The title is essentially the report:

Verified on Chat Completions:

  • an empty tool list is accepted, "tools": [],
  • an empty tools list was also a convention often seen elsewhere (the playground now fixed in sending this even against gpt-5-chat).
  • ISSUE: the AI model STILL gets the internal tool "multi_tool_use" placed == confusing and distracting tokens.

  1. Output the body of the multi_tool_use tool description, ensuring this report is based on actual seen and expected tool language.

Here is the body of the multi_tool_use tool description as seen in the # Tools section:

// This tool serves as a wrapper for utilizing multiple tools. Each tool that can be used must be specified in the tool sections. Only tools in the functions namespace are permitted.
// Ensure that the parameters provided to each tool are valid according to that tool's specification.
namespace multi_tool_use {

// Use this function to run multiple tools simultaneously, but only if they can operate in parallel. Do this even if the prompt suggests using the tools sequentially.
type parallel = (_: {
// The tools to be executed in parallel. NOTE: only functions tools are permitted
tool_uses: {
// The name of the tool to use. The format should either be just the name of the tool, or in the format namespace.function_name for plugin and function tools.
recipient_name: string,
// The parameters to pass to the tool. Ensure these are valid according to the tool's own specifications.
parameters: object,
}[],
}) => any;

} // namespace multi_tool_use

Summary for bug report:

  • multi_tool_use is present, but there are no functions in the functions namespace to use with it.
  • This makes the presence of multi_tool_use currently non-functional and its placement pointless.
  • The tool description is as quoted above.

Needed resolution:

  • an empty tools list should be rewritten as equivalent to null
  • no internal tools the AI can’t use!
  • do NOT write internal tool instructions that tell the AI to disobey the developer (showing above)
  • improve documentation about models that cannot call in parallel anyway
